Originally Posted by dabusabus1
What do u mean it feels cheap? its a $800 amp. and i was comparing it to the 1000/1 jl amp. and what features does the jl have over the PG?

For an $800 amp, I'd expect the xenon to have better material (knock on the top of the amp, you'll know what i'm talking about). The first year xenon had major problems, unlike the tantrum that it replaced. PG has gone a bit downhill.



The JL does have a selectable 12db or 24db/octave xover with a frequency multiplier (x10). It also has a parametric EQ. None of these matter if you're going active though (at least before the signal gets to the amp).

Originally Posted by GSteg
For an $800 amp, I'd expect the xenon to have better material (knock on the top of the amp, you'll know what i'm talking about). The first year xenon had major problems, unlike the tantrum that it replaced. PG has gone a bit downhill.
P/G always had major wrinkles with their first few runs.
Xenon replaced the Titanium line which also had major problems during its first few runs. The Xenon amplifiers have huge potential to be a contender in the mid/high end pro-sumer market they just need to work out the few of the bugs that are still lurking. for now tho, my advice is to stay far away from them.

Arc makes an awesome amp!
JBL wouldn't stand up to any of the above mentioned amps, neither in SQ, SPL, or just plain old craftsmanship.


: If u want a good amp go back to the basics; look at were the amp is made, that'll tell u a lot about the amps quality and remember "designed" and "manufactured" are two very different things. Obviously Euro is the way to go but the US is making good product too, Korea seems to be in the running as one of the new Japans and China has gotten a little better in the past 5 years. If all else fails never forget the golden rule: $1=1watt (unless of course ur being hooked up or ripped off)


lastly: an 800 dollar amp is 1 that u should have for a long time so don't limit urself to just a couple options. If u don't know much about ARC u may wanna hold up on ur purchase and do a little reading, also look at Brax, Diamond and Audison while ur at it. but wile ur heads buried in that mag; try to caution urself away from those newer/smaller companies that put a lot into advertising pages and aesthetic design. That's usually a tail tell that their priorities are in the wrong place and or they're R&D team needs a bigger budget. [[{{{*ie. Audiobahn*}}}]]
